João Domingos Bomtempo

Considered by many, the "Portuguese Beethoven", he is the most important Portuguese composer of the classical period. Bomtempo is a composer that deserves to be celebrated, not only for the impact that had in the Portuguese musical history, but also for his unique compositional style that…

Francisco de Lacerda

One of the composers that I consider a hidden gem. Just like Vianna da Motta, it had contact with some of the great artists of his times. He moved to Paris still very young, where he studied with Vincent d'Indy and was influenced by the music of Franck, Fauré, Ravel, Poulenc e Dukas. His body of work is not as vast as the two composers referred in previous pages, but just like Vianna da Motta, he is a symbol of the Portuguese musical nationalism which we find specially in his two song cycles "Trovas".
